BBC - Radio 4 Woman’s Hour - Ingrid Mattson
This is an interview I heard today while out driving; Ingrid Mattson (president of the Islamic Society of North America and the first female, first non-immigrant and first convert to hold that post) tells basically her life story, talks a bit about her new book “The Story of the Koran”, and fields a few questions on Islam and what it offers women.
